The Genesis of Charcoal Soap

Charcoal has been used for centuries across cultures for its medicinal and purifying properties. When incorporated into soap, activated charcoal undergoes a process that makes it porous and highly absorbent. This makes it an effective tool for drawing out impurities, toxins, and excess oils from the skin’s surface.

The Magic of Charcoal for Skin

Activated charcoal possesses a unique ability to attract and bind to particles, making it an excellent candidate for skincare. Its absorption properties help unclog pores, making it particularly beneficial for individuals with oily and acne-prone skin. Additionally, charcoal’s gentle exfoliating action can lead to a smoother, brighter complexion by removing dead skin cells.

Benefits of Charcoal Soap

  • Deep Cleansing: Charcoal soap dives deep into pores to extract dirt, oil, and pollutants, leaving your skin feeling refreshed.
  • Acne Management: Its ability to absorb excess oil and bacteria can aid in preventing and managing acne breakouts.
  • Gentle Exfoliation: Charcoal soap’s texture offers mild exfoliation, promoting skin cell turnover and radiance.
  • Balancing Oily Skin: For those with oily skin, charcoal soap helps balance sebum production, reducing that greasy feeling.
  • Reduced Pore Appearance: Regular use of charcoal soap can lead to minimized pores, giving your skin a smoother appearance.

Incorporating Charcoal Soap into Your Routine

Adding charcoal soap to your skincare regimen is a simple process:

  1. Start Gradually: If you’re new to charcoal soap, begin by using it every other day to allow your skin to adjust.
  2. Lather and Apply: Create a lather with the soap and gently massage it onto damp skin using circular motions.
  3. Rinse Thoroughly: Rinse your face with lukewarm water, ensuring all traces of the soap are removed.
  4. Moisturize: Follow up with a lightweight, hydrating moisturizer to maintain your skin’s balance.

Choosing the Right Charcoal Soap

As with any skincare product, quality matters. When selecting charcoal soap:

  • Read Labels: Look for soaps with natural ingredients and a high charcoal content.
  • Skin Type: Choose a soap tailored to your skin type—whether it’s sensitive, oily, or combination.
  • Avoid Harsh Additives: Opt for products without harsh chemicals that could counteract the benefits of charcoal.

Precautions and Side Effects

While charcoal soap is generally safe, consider the following:

  • Patch Test: Perform a patch test before using charcoal soap extensively to check for adverse reactions.
  • Dryness: Overuse may lead to dryness, so ensure you moisturize adequately.
  • Sun Sensitivity: Some users report increased sun sensitivity, so sun protection is essential.
